Section 1: Access & Permissions Validation

Twilio Console Access

  • Twilio Console Admin Access: Can log into Twilio Console with full admin privileges
  • Account SID Available: Located and copied Account SID (format: ACx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x)
  • Auth Token Available: Located and copied Auth Token (secure access)
  • Twilio CLI Configured: twilio profiles:list shows active profile

Validation Commands:

# Test Twilio CLI access
twilio api:core:accounts:fetch
# Should return account details without errors

# Test profile configuration
twilio profiles:list
# Should show active profile with checkmark

Section 3: Technical Requirements Validation

Twilio Resources Discovery

  • Workspace SID Located: WS________________________________
  • "Assign to Anyone" Workflow SID Located: WW________________________________
  • Flex Service Available: Confirmed Flex is active and accessible
  • TaskRouter Configured: Confirmed TaskRouter workspace is operational

Validation Commands:

# Find Workspace SID
twilio api:taskrouter:v1:workspaces:list
# Copy the SID starting with WS

# Find Workflow SID
twilio api:taskrouter:v1:workspaces:workflows:list \
--workspace-sid WSx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x
# Find "Assign to Anyone" workflow, copy SID starting with WW

Final Pre-Deployment Validation

Mandatory Validation Commands

Run these commands before deployment:

# 1. Verify Twilio CLI access
twilio api:core:accounts:fetch

# 2. Confirm Workspace and Workflow SIDs
twilio api:taskrouter:v1:workspaces:list
twilio api:taskrouter:v1:workspaces:workflows:list \
--workspace-sid WSx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x

# 3. Test current serverless functions
twilio api:serverless:v1:services:environments:variables:list \
--service-sid ZS... --environment-sid ZE...

# 4. Verify git status clean
git status
# Should show "working tree clean"

# 5. Test build environment
cd serverless-functions
npm install
npm run build
# Should complete without errors
